Web14 jan. 2024 · 5. Speaking the truth got John the Baptist killed. Considering his lifestyle, John the Baptist clearly didn’t care what others thought of him, even when those others had great power. When Herod Antipas, the Roman ruler of Galilee, took his brother’s wife as his own, John the Baptist spoke out against it. Web5 nov. 2024 · The most complete story of John’s birth is found in Luke 1. It starts with the introduction of John’s parents, the priest Zachariah and his wife Elizabeth, a relative of Jesus’ mother Mary. They were both considered righteous, and devout in observing God’s laws. One day while doing his duties, Zachariah received a very unexpected visitor.
